An online lecture series will be conducted on STEAM-Based Curriculum Development for Early Childhood Education. The preparation of weekly plans, daily plans, and lesson plans related to the first semester of early childhood education will be discussed in the lecture series. Teaching methods for implementing these activities, as well as how they can be adapted as STEAM-based activities, will also be covered.

Educators from Sri Lanka, as well as international lecturers, will conduct sessions for teachers in the global community. Not only early childhood development teachers but also parents and other stakeholders will benefit from this lecture series.

Live Lectures Schedule:

  • Monday (09:30 PM – 11:00 PM): Curriculum Designing for Early Childhood Education
  • Wednesday (07:00 PM – 08:30 PM): Best Practices in Curriculum Development and Lesson Plans
  • Thusday (07:00 PM – 08:30 PM): STEAM Implementation in Early Childhood Curriculum
  • Friday (07:00 PM – 08:30 PM): Implementation of Modern Teaching Methods in Classroom Activities

Teachers who complete the lecture series, assignments, and the final examination will be awarded an Advanced Diploma in STEAM Education (Level 03).

International Diploma in STEAM Education (Stage 1)



“International Project for Capacity Development of Early Childhood Development Teachers (IPFCD)
International Lecture Series on STEAM Education

International Diploma in STEAM Education.

This lecture series has been designed to enhance educators’ knowledge of STEAM education, modern teaching methodologies, and emerging trends in pre-primary and primary education.

All lecture videos have been systematically organized and uploaded under four stages: Stage 1, Stage 2, Stage 3, and Stage 4. Participants are encouraged to watch all videos to gain up-to-date insights and practical understanding in the field.

Educators who complete the assignments and successfully pass the final examination associated with the lecture series will be eligible to receive an International Diploma in STEAM Education.

Parallel to the International Conference Series on Quality Early Childhood Education, the South Asian International Association for Early Childhood Care and Development is implementing the ‘International Project for Capacity Development of Early Childhood Development Teachers (IPFCD),’ 

An online lecture series will be conducted on

  • STEAM Education in Early Childhood Education. 
  • Modern Approaches in Early Childhood Education
  • Best Practices of STEAM in Early Childhood Education, 
  • Early Childhood Education in other countries.
  • Communication skills Development in English Language 

Lectures will be conducted in

  • English Medium
  • Sinhala medium
  • Tamil Medium

Participants will be qualified as modern ECCD teachers with new pedagogical approaches and newly updated knowledge on early childhood education. They will gain proper knowledge of the best practices of other South Asian countries in ECCD education.

At the end, participants’ competencies are evaluated, and participants who complete the lecture series successfully will get an “Advanced Certificate on STEAM Education and Modern Approaches” at the certificate awarding ceremony.
